Abstract

Traditional cultural values are the crystallization of all the best things through the historical flow of the nation to create its own identity, passed down to future generations and will be supplemented to add new values over time. Traditional cultural values play a huge role in building Vietnamese's cultural value system and human standards. Therefore, inheriting traditional cultural values in building the cultural value system and human standards of Vietnam is an objective necessity, and is also a regular, long-term, persistent and persistent work under the leadership of the Communist Party of Vietnam (CPV) and the cooperation of the entire society. Using the qualitative research method, this study focuses on clarifying: The role of traditional cultural values in building the cultural value system and human standards of Vietnam today, the achievements and limitations of inheriting traditional cultural values in building a system of cultural values and standards for Vietnamese people, some basic solutions to inherit traditional cultural values in building a system of cultural values and standards Vietnamese people today.
